Tennessee Enacts New Construction Legislation in 2020

The Tennessee Construction Industry Payment Protection Act was signed into law on June 22. The Act addresses or reallocates certain risks associated with non-payment on construction projects under Tennessee’s Prompt Pay Act (PPA) and is intended to increase clarity and consistency in the PPA and in Tennessee’s mechanics’ lien law, Truth in Construction and Consumer…...
